Hot reloading refreshes the execution context of your plugin panel. If your plugin relies on volatile, in-memory JavaScript variables, that local state will reset during a reload. To preserve state across refreshes while developing, temporarily back up data to the host document's metadata or leverage UXP’s local file storage APIs. In traditional plugin development (CEP or older ExtendScript), testing a code change required a tedious workflow: Save the file in your code editor. Close the host application (e.g., Photoshop). Relaunch the host application.

⚡ As soon as you save changes to your JavaScript, CSS, or HTML files, the UDT reloads the plugin inside the running host application automatically. or HTML files
